Backhoe excavation services involve the use of a versatile, heavy-duty machine equipped with a large bucket and digging arm to perform a variety of earth-moving tasks. These services are commonly used for digging trenches, foundations, and drainage systems, as well as for removing large amounts of soil or debris from a property. The process typically involves precise excavation to prepare a site for construction, landscaping, or other development projects. By utilizing a backhoe, contractors can efficiently handle large-scale digging tasks that would be time-consuming and labor-intensive with manual tools alone.
This service helps address common property problems such as poor drainage, uneven terrain, or the need for foundation repairs. For homeowners experiencing issues with standing water or improper grading, backhoe excavation can be used to reshape the land to promote better runoff and prevent flooding. It is also useful for removing old concrete, clearing out overgrown areas, or creating new features like ponds or retaining walls. The overview below groups typical Backhoe Excavation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lafayette,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For routine excavation tasks like trenching or minor site prep,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many projects fall within this range, especially for straightforward jobs that require minimal equipment and time.
Mid-Size Projects - Larger tasks such as driveway excavation or small foundation work usually cost between $600 and $2,500. These projects are common and often involve more extensive use of equipment and labor, but still stay within a moderate cost band.
Major Excavations - Large-scale projects like pond digging or significant grading can range from $2,500 to $5,000 or more. While fewer jobs reach these higher costs, they are typical for complex or extensive excavation needs.
Full Replacement or Heavy-Duty Work - Complete site overhauls or extensive land clearing may exceed $5,000, with costs varying based on scope and site conditions. Such projects are less common but represent the upper end of typical excavation expenses handled by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
